Success Story: How Okta Generated Opportunities with an AI-Driven ABM Strategy
Okta teamed up with RollWorks to boost its Account-Based Marketing (ABM) program using AI. They focused on intent-based ABM campaigns. This move helped Okta get more chances and make more money.

Okta’s use of intent-based ABM campaigns had big results. Their AI strategy brought them 24 times more chances. They could go after top accounts more precisely. This new approach, fueled by AI, made Okta focus on the best accounts for turning into new business.
Using AI also cut the time from finding opportunities to sealing deals by 63%. By analyzing customer intent, they could sell better and faster. This made their sales smoother and more productive.
The AI strategy really improved Okta’s revenue. They saw a 22% boost in influenced revenue. This shows how powerful AI is in improving ABM and bringing real results.

What is Account-Based Marketing?
Account-Based Marketing (ABM) is all about focusing on specific customer groups with personalized campaigns. This strategy is different from the usual marketing ways. It targets key high-value accounts directly, bringing a personalized experience to the customer.
ABM stands out because it focuses efforts on select accounts. This leads to better engagement and more precise marketing strategies. For companies, this means reaching the right customers with the exact messages they need.
Research shows ABM is very effective. It beats other marketing strategies for 87% of B2B marketers. On average, companies see a 171% increase in deal size using ABM. This approach is excellent for not just attracting new customers but keeping the existing ones happy.

Types of ABM Strategies
There are three main types of Account-Based Marketing (ABM). Each has its own focus and level of personalization. Companies pick the best type based on their resources, who they are targeting, and their goals. These three types are:
-
One to Many (1:Many) ABM Strategy
One to Many ABM strategy aims at reaching a large, general audience. This lets businesses get their message out to many people. It’s good for creating brand awareness and talking to lots of potential customers at once. For instance, Salesforce holds webinars that big companies can join.
-
One to Few (1:Few) ABM Strategy
The One to Few ABM strategy targets a smaller group of accounts with similar traits. This approach lets companies tailor messages to a handful of accounts. It’s handy when businesses want to address specific needs of similar clients. The Food and Beverage sector might use this for important clients facing similar challenges.
-
One to One (1:1) ABM Strategy
The One to One ABM strategy is the most tailor-made form of ABM. Companies focus entirely on the unique needs of single, high-value accounts. This deep level of customization builds strong client relationships. For instance, Coca-Cola designs marketing just for their most important clients.
Choosing the right ABM strategy means considering a company’s resources, audience, and goals. With the correct strategy, businesses can see more engagement, better conversion rates, and an increase in revenue.
Challenges of Implementing ABM
Account-Based Marketing (ABM) faces a few hurdles. To succeed, organizations must handle Sales and Marketing being in sync, ensure data’s precise, customize content, and measure ROI accurately.
Sales and Marketing Alignment
Uniting Sales and Marketing is crucial for ABM. Both need to work as a team. They should pick target accounts together, set messages, and align their efforts. This harmony needs to break down walls and make sure everyone is on the same page.
Data Accuracy
Accurate data is a must in ABM. Wrong or missing data wastes effort and opportunities. Firms need strong data management. This involves keeping data up to date, cleaning it regularly, and connecting to reliable sources.
Content Personalization
Personalized content is key in ABM. But finding the balance between efficiency and personal touch can be tough. It’s essential to understand your target accounts deeply. AI tools can make creating and sending personalized content easier.
ROI in ABM
Measuring ABM’s ROI is more intricate than standard marketing. ABM focuses on high-value accounts and often takes time to show results. Setting clear goals, tracking metrics, and using strong measurement tools are vital. This way, the impact of ABM on sales and acquiring new customers can be properly assessed.
Despite its hurdles, organizations can succeed with ABM. They should focus on aligning Sales and Marketing, improving data accuracy, personalizing content, and setting up good measurement methods. Tackling these challenges can open doors to effective, revenue-boosting marketing and solid customer relationships.
